Mr. Spencer R. Mason (late lieutenant in the R.N.V.R.) returned to Wellington by the Paparoa last week. He left Wellington at the end of 1916 as a sublieutenant ml the Motor- Boat Patrol, and served in the Auxiliary Patrol in the Adriatic, Mediterranean, and jEgean Seas (anti-submarine warfare). ' Mr. Mason, who is the second son of Mr. and Mrs. H. B. Mason, of Wellington, saw many of the world's famous cities during his war service, spending some time in Rome and Constantinople. While -waiting for a boat to return to New Zealandhe had an opportunity of seeing much of England. He was well known in yacht, ing circles in Wellington and Auckland, and at the time of entering the naval service was practising his profeutoii as a aottcitqr.-in :Waiaku^ Aucklaii4 „
